Property prices in Kawagoe
Median sale prices in Kawagoe, Mie from real transactions (2023Q2–2026Q1) — homes, apartments, and land, plus the current for-sale market.
- Median home price
- ¥20.0M
- Home ¥/m²
- ¥162K/m²
- 3-year change
- -29.8%
- For sale now
- 79
By home price per m², Kawagoe ranks #2 of 29 municipalities in Mie and #468 of 1684 nationwide.
Prices by property type
| Type | Median sold price | ¥/m² (25–75% range) | 3y change | Median asking price | For sale |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Homes | ¥20.0M | ¥162K/m²¥122K–¥209K | -29.8% | ¥31.8M | 35 |
| Land | ¥13.0M | ¥30K/m²¥18K–¥58K | +3.4% | ¥12.0M | 44 |
Only segments with at least 5 transactions are shown. Apartments carry no reliable unit-size data, so their ¥/m² is omitted.

About this data
Source: MLIT (Japan's Ministry of Land, Infrastructure, Transport and Tourism) real estate transaction records, 2023Q2–2026Q1. Only segments with at least 5 transactions are shown. For-sale figures come from active listings tracked and deduplicated by Japan Property Research.
